Transaction

10dbf8aead89efa40b1d147e911d1dc2ddda27302b77483e899541e8960f0cf1

Summary

In Block679404
TimeWed, 01 May 2024 23:18:00 UTC
Total Input647.91145767 Nebula
Total Output681.91145767 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
290632 Confirmations681.91145767 Nebula
Raw Transaction